And since all good things must come to an end, Kendra and her brood have said goodbye to E! and are waving hello to a whole new reality family...

With WE tv!

The cable net today announced that it's greenlit the cheekily named Kendra on Top, a new docu-soap that will undoubtedly pick up where her E! series Kendra left off, following the buxom blonde as she "gets her groove back" all while balancing her personal and professional life.

"I'm so excited to be joining the WE tv family!" Kendra said. "I'm thrilled to continue showing the world my story and everything that's coming up in my life."

Not to mention, everything that comes up in hubby Hank Baskett and adorable son Hank IV's lives, who will be coming along, as always, for the reality ride.

The show has yet to go into production, but filming is expected to begin in Los Angeles this month.

The 14-episode-strong debut season of the show will begin airing on WE this summer.
